如何在TP中进行签名以及其详细步骤解析
在加密货币快速发展的今天,数字的使用变得尤为重要。TP作为一款多功能的数字货币,用户在进行交易或者管理资产时,常常需要进行签名操作。签名不仅是为了确保交易的安全性,也是为了证明交易的发生和确认其合法性。因此,了解TP中的签名流程对于数字资产的安全管理具有重要意义。
本文将详细介绍在TP中如何进行签名,并围绕这一主题回答五个常见问题,帮助用户更好地理解和执行签名操作。
一、TP签名操作的基本流程
TP支持多种数字货币的存储和交易,用户在进行资产管理时,通常需要对交易进行签名。以下是TP签名操作的基本步骤:
1. **下载并安装TP**:首先,用户需要确保已经在手机上安装了TP。TP支持iOS和Android系统,用户可以在各大应用商店中找到并下载安装。
2. **创建或导入**:打开TP后,用户可以选择创建一个新或导入已有的。如果选择创建新,需要设置密码并妥善保存助记词;如果导入已有,需要输入助记词或者私钥。
3. **进入交易界面**:完成的创建或导入后,用户可以在主界面上看到资产余额。进行交易时,用户需要点击“交易”或“发送”按钮,进入交易界面。在此界面中,用户需要填写接收方地址、发送的金额等信息。
4. **签名交易**:当用户填写完交易信息后,点击“确认”按钮,TP会自动生成一笔待签名的交易。在这一步,用户需要输入密码,以确认此次交易是本人发起的。通过输入密码后,TP会对交易信息进行签名,确保交易的有效性和安全性。
5. **发送签名交易**:签名完成后,TP会将交易信息发送到区块链网络中,等待区块链网络的确认。在这一过程中,用户可以查看交易状态,包括是否成功、需支付的交易手续费等信息。
二、签名的技术原理是什么?
在讨论TP签名操作时,有必要深入了解签名的技术原理。签名是区块链技术中至关重要的一部分,通常涉及到密码学中的公钥和私钥体系。
1. **公钥和私钥**:区块链上的每个地址都对应一对密钥,即公钥和私钥。公钥用于生成地址并接收资金,私钥用于对交易进行签名,是保证交易安全的关键。用户必须将私钥保密,因为任何拥有私钥的人都可以控制相应的和资产。
2. **数字签名的过程**:当用户发起交易时,TP会使用私钥对交易信息进行签名。这个过程包括对交易数据进行哈希计算,然后使用私钥对哈希值加密,生成数字签名。这个签名与交易数据一起发送到区块链网络中。
3. **验证签名的过程**:在区块链网络中,节点收到交易信息后,会根据交易中的公钥对签名进行验证。具体来说,节点会对哈希值进行解密,并将解密后的结果与新的哈希值进行比对。如果两者相同,说明签名有效,交易被确认;如果不相同,则说明交易信息被篡改,签名无效。
三、为什么需要进行交易签名?
许多用户可能会疑问,为什么TP中的签名如此重要?以下是几个关键原因:
1. **确保交易的合法性**:签名是数字交易的身份验证机制,只有拥有私钥的用户才能对交易进行签名,从而证明交易是由真实的资产拥有者发起的。这有效防止了伪造交易的风险。
2. **防止交易篡改**:在交易被签名后,交易数据的一部分与签名生成密切相关。若有人企图篡改交易内容,签名将会失效,网络中节点的验证机制会及时识别出这样的伪造行为,确保交易的原始性和完整性。
3. **提高安全性**:数字货币的价值高,任何安全漏洞都可能导致资产的损失。通过对交易进行签名,TP能有效防范黑客攻击和恶意行为,提升用户资产的安全性。
4. **合规性要求**:随着区块链技术的普及,监管逐渐加强,要求交易行为需有完善的合规流程。交易签名作为交易的有效凭证,可以满足合规性要求,从而减少潜在的法律和合规风险。
四、如何确保TP签名的安全性?
为了保证用户在TP中进行的签名操作始终安全可靠,建议采取以下措施:
1. **妥善保管私钥**:私钥是控制数字资产的关键,应当采取安全措施妥善存储,包括使用冷存储设备或者硬件。在未必要的情况下,不建议将私钥保存在联网的设备中。
2. **定期更新软件**:TP开发团队会不断推陈出新,修复漏洞和增强安全性。定期检查并更新软件,有助于确保您使用的是最新版本,获得最佳的安全保护。
3. **设置强密码**:在创建TP时,用户需设置复杂度较高的密码,并定期更换。这能够有效阻止未授权访问,避免因密码泄漏而导致的资产损失。
4. **启用双因素认证**:如果TP支持双因素认证(2FA),建议用户启用该功能。2FA增加了额外的安全层,即使密码被盗,若没有手机或二次验证工具,资产安全也会有保障。
5. **保持警惕,避免钓鱼攻击**:用户在使用TP时,要提高警惕,谨防钓鱼攻击。避免点击不明链接,确保访问的是TP的官方网站或可信的应用商店,避免下载恶意软件。
五、如何解决在TP签名时遇到的问题?
用户在进行TP的签名操作时,可能会遇到各种问题。以下是一些常见的问题及其解决方案:
1. **签名失败**:如果在进行签名时提示“签名失败”,首先检查账户余额是否充足,确保交易费用已足够,并检查私钥是否保护妥当。
2. **交易未确认**:当交易的状态显示为“未确认”时,可能网络拥堵或者手续费设置过低。此时,可以尝试提高手续费并重新发送交易。
3. **账户被锁定**:如果您多次输入错误的密码,TP可能会锁定账户。通常情况下,可以通过邮件找回密码,或者使用助记词恢复账户。
4. **交易记录缺失**:若发现交易记录未显示,可能是地理位置或网络连接问题导致数据未能同步。用户可尝试切换网络或刷新应用。
5. **无法连接到节点**:如果TP提示无法连接到节点,可能是因为服务器故障或网络问题。建议用户检查网络连接,并选择不同的节点尝试重新连接。
六、总结
在TP中进行交易签名是一项不可或缺的重要操作,确保交易的合法性、安全性与完整性。通过以上的操作步骤和注意事项,用户可以更加自信地管理自己的数字资产,同时保持警惕,以避免潜在的安全风险。希望本文对您在TP中的签名操作有所帮助,进一步增强您对数字货币管理的理解与掌控。